Hart-Parr Row Crop 18-27

Production: 1930 - 1935  

Production

Manufacturer:Hart-Parr (a part of Oliver)
Type:Row-Crop tractor
Factory:Charles City, Iowa, USA
Introduced in 1930, the Oliver Hart-Parr Row Crop featured a single front wheel during the first two production years. In 1931, the design changed to use two front wheels.

Hart-Parr Row Crop 18-27 Power

Drawbar (claimed):18 hp 13.4 kW
Belt (claimed):27 hp 20.1 kW
Plows:2-3 (14-inch)
Drawbar (tested):18.10 hp 13.5 kW
Belt (tested):29.72 hp 22.2 kW
